Seeking interest from service providers
Scheduled to open in 2027, the Byford Health Hub ('the Hub') is an important infrastructure project for the local community, allowing people to access specialist health and community-based care closer to home.
To help inform future Hub services, East Metropolitan Health Service (EMHS) is seeking information from service providers who may be interested in delivering one or more of the following services as an occupant of the Byford Health Hub:
- Primary care
- Episodic urgent care; and/or
- Limited medical imaging (i.e. mobile X-ray and/or general ultrasound)
The Byford Health Hub will offer service providers an opportunity to utilise space within the Hub under an occupancy agreement such as a licence or lease. EMHS is seeking information from interested Respondents with the capability and resources to deliver services within the Hub, noting that:
- Clinical and financial governance will remain with service providers that occupy the Hub;
- EMHS will not be procuring/paying occupants for the delivery of services; and
- Patient accounts will be managed directly between service providers and consumers of the service.
About the Byford Health Hub
The Hub will provide a single-entry point for families and individuals in the Shire of Serpentine-Jarrahdale and surrounding region, with access to a range of primary care, community, social and specialist health services in one convenient location. It also provides a unique opportunity to shape a shared approach to integrating health and social services to positively impact the health and wellbeing of the community.
Service providers will include a mix of private and not-for-profit, in conjunction with a comprehensive range of on-site outpatient services provided by WA Health. EMHS is coordinating the program planning, development and commissioning, with input from clinicians, Traditional Owners and local community.
